Willems' work combines elegance, modernity, and timeless themes in pieces that are as unique as they are innovative—the result of an ancient technique reinterpreted through a contemporary lens. Pyrography is an ancient art form practiced by humankind. Fire and wood, timeless elements, are the sole mediums through which Willems' exploration unfolds, standing out in the field of figurative art for its power and transience. Through a slow creative process, he uses various heat sources to "paint" the surface of wooden panels, following the natural grain to create contrasts between smooth areas and the rough, charred sections left by the fire. In *Untitled Forest XI*, this exploration takes the form of a forest scene on eucalyptus wood, whose pale, striated grain becomes part of the composition, with the burn marks appearing almost like light filtering through the trees. His work has been exhibited in Berlin, London, and Milan, and has been particularly well-received in China, including exhibitions at the Shaanxi Provincial Museum and the Xi'an Museum of Contemporary Art, and inclusion in the permanent collection of the Qujian Yin Art Museum in Xi'an since 2022. In 2023, Willems won the "Earth's Wild Beauty" category at the "David Shepherd Wildlife Artist of the Year" competition in London, competing against more than 1,400 international entrants.

Federica Galli's Biography Proudly present into Google art and Culture A prominent figure in the art of engraving in Italy, Federica Galli was born in 1932 in Soresina - a village just outside Cremona- in the north of the country. Straight after the war, in 1946, she convinced her parents to enrol her at the Artistic Lyceum in Milan. In 1950, she attended the Academy of Fine Arts of Brera, from where she graduated four years later with a diploma in painting. She began engraving in 1954 - "Il paese dell'Alberta"- experimenting with etching, a technique she never abandoned for the rest of her life. In 1966 she married the journalist Giovanni Raimondi – editor-in-chief of the Corriere della Sera. During that time she began to embark on a densely packed programme of cultural trips that took her to the most important European cities and to countries where the art of engraving is less deeply rooted. These were also the year in which she matured the conviction that engraving was the technique in which she expressed herself most effectively and started to apply herself exclusively to this art form, producing over eight hundred different subjects. Starting from her early personal exhibitions – the first one took place in 1960 in Milan – she met with the favour of the public and critics alike. In the space of a few years, she could count on the support of some of the most authoritative critics of her time: Franco Russoli, Mario de Micheli, Giovanni Testori – who was to follow her closely until he died - Mina Gregori, Gian Alberto dell'Acqua, Roberto Tassi, Renzo Zorzi, Carlo Bo, Daniel Berger (Metropolitan Museum of New York), Gina Lagorio, Giuseppe and Francesco Frangi, Marco Fragonara, Giorgio Soavi and David Landau (Oxford University). She obtained the most prestigious institutional acknowledgements given to any contemporary artist: she was the first living artist to be invited to exhibit at the Fondazione Cini in Venice - 1987 with a collection dedicated to the lagoon city - ; at the Civic Museum of Palazzo Te in Mantua - 1987 -; at the Castello Sforzesco in Milan - 1988 - ; in the Imperial Archive of the Forbid-den City, Wag Fung gallery, - 1995 -.
